Finance secured for new terminal at Bergen airport

1 Jun 15 Norwegian airport operating company Avinor has secured finance for the new passenger terminal under construction at Flesland airport near Bergen in western Norway.

The agreement with the Nordic Investment Bank provides NOK1bn (£84m) for the construction of a new terminal, T3, to accommodate growing passenger numbers. In the past 10 years, there has been 6% growth every year and the airport’s maximum capacity – six million people – was reached two years ago.

T3 will add six gates equipped with jet bridges and expand the airport’s surface area almost fourfold, to 85,000m2, increasing the annual capacity to 10 million people. The new terminal will be designated for domestic air traffic, while the existing building will be primarily used for international passengers. Construction work is expected to be completed by the end of the summer in 2017.
